What are short term rental (Airbnb, VRBO) regulations in Hawthorne,California?

If you're an Airbnb host or considering dipping your toes into the short-term rental market in Hawthorne, California, understanding the local regulations is crucial. This vibrant city has implemented specific rules to strike a balance between embracing the economic opportunities of vacation rentals and preserving the character of its residential neighborhoods.

Hawthorne's approach to short-term rentals (STRs) is best described as cautious yet accommodating. While the city recognizes the benefits of this burgeoning industry, it has put measures in place to ensure responsible operation and maintain quality of life for residents.

At the heart of Hawthorne's STR regulations is the requirement for hosts to obtain a Short-Term Rental Permit from the city's Planning Department. This permit serves as your license to operate legally within the city limits. The application process involves providing details about your rental property, owner information, and designating a local contact person available 24/7 to address any issues that may arise.

Transparency is key when it comes to Hawthorne's STR rules. Hosts must maintain a comprehensive guest log with names, contact information, and vehicle details for each booking. This log must be readily available for inspection by city officials upon request. Additionally, proof of a Transient Occupancy Tax Registration Certificate is mandatory, as hosts are required to collect and remit these taxes on their rental income.

Operational guidelines are another essential aspect of Hawthorne's STR regulations. These include limitations on the number of guests per bedroom, parking requirements, noise restrictions during nighttime hours, and a cap on the maximum number of rental days per calendar year. Failure to comply with these rules can result in fines or the revocation of your permit.

Short Term Rental Licensing Requirement in Hawthorne

If you're considering joining the modern rental economy by listing your Hawthorne property on platforms like Airbnb or VRBO, be prepared to go through official channels first. The city has implemented a strict permitting process to regulate short-term rental (STR) operations within its limits.

Hosting guests for short stays of less than 30 nights is prohibited in Hawthorne unless you obtain a valid Short-Term Rental Permit from the Planning Department. This isn't just a formality - operating an unlicensed STR can result in hefty fines and penalties.

The permit application requires detailed information about the rental unit, including the address, number of bedrooms and bathrooms, maximum occupancy, and parking provisions. You'll also need to identify a local contact person who can respond to issues at the property within one hour, 24 hours a day, seven days a week.

Permits are issued on an annual basis, so hosts must renew each year to remain compliant. The application and renewal fees help cover the city's costs for administering and enforcing the STR program.

Hawthorne Short Term Rental Taxes

As a short-term rental host in Hawthorne, you have a legal obligation to collect and remit transient occupancy taxes (TOT) on your rental income to the city. This tax applies to all short-term stays of 30 consecutive days or less.The transient occupancy tax rate in Hawthorne is 14% of the rent charged to your guests. This consists of a 12% general tax plus an additional 2% tourism marketing district assessment.

Failure to pay the required TOT can result in penalties, interest charges, and potential legal action from the city. It's essential to take this tax obligation seriously.

To comply, you must first obtain a Transient Occupancy Tax Registration Certificate from the City of Hawthorne Finance Department. This certificate allows you to collect and remit the TOT lawfully.The TOT must be paid to the city on a monthly basis. Even if you had no bookings in a given month, you must still file a tax return showing $0 in taxable rent.

Detailed records of all short-term rental transactions, including guest receipts, must be maintained for a minimum of three years for auditing purposes.

By understanding and properly paying transient occupancy taxes, you ensure your short-term rental business remains compliant with Hawthorne's regulations. Consult the city's TOT guidance or a qualified tax professional if you have any other questions.

Hawthorne wide Short Term Rental Rules

Hawthorne has implemented a comprehensive set of regulations to govern the operation of short-term rentals within city limits. These rules are designed to strike a balance between allowing residents to benefit from the sharing economy while preserving the character and quality of life in residential neighborhoods. Failure to comply can result in penalties and fines.

One Rental Per Residence Per Night
To prevent investor-owned de facto hotels, Hawthorne only permits one rental period or booking per residence per night. This ensures properties retain their residential nature.

Strict Occupancy Limits
Occupancy is capped at two guests per bedroom, plus two additional guests. This occupancy maximum aims to prevent excessive noise, parking issues, and overcrowding.

No Rentals in Accessory Structures
Only fully-permitted, permanent residential structures like single-family homes, townhomes, and multifamily units are approved for short-term rentals. Renting out sheds, RVs, or other accessory structures is strictly prohibited.

Adequate Parking Required
Hosts must provide one off-street parking space for themselves and one space for their guests' use during the rental period. This parking provision helps reduce street congestion.

Quiet Hours Enforced
To respect neighbors, short-term rentals must comply with Hawthorne's noise restrictions between the hours of 7pm and 7am daily. Excessive noise can lead to citations.

Annual Rental Cap of 90 Days
Short-term rental operators cannot rent out their property for more than a cumulative 90 days per calendar year. This prevents long-term removal of housing from the market.
